Transaction 53a19f14898c89ac139b22d7e7595c140c303ffe6c3c51981fe7e0a0ce81ad09
1 Input
1 Output
-
53a19f14898c89ac139b22d7e7595c140c303ffe6c3c51981fe7e0a0ce81ad09:0
- value
- 23980000
- script pubkey
- OP_0 OP_PUSHBYTES_20 acc29212aa0e1b010422a3723795695a14093afb
- address
- bc1q4npfyy42pcdszppz5der09tftg2qjwhmce0td4